A sense of wonder

by Piers Plowright

 

The other day, I asked my son when he thought the sense of wonder dis­appeared. We both agreed that we all begin with it, but it is then either snuffed out or dwindles away or appears suddenly and for a moment before vanishing again. For theatre director, actor, priest, writer, teacher and traveller James Roose-Evans, the wonder never seems to have gone away.
